Transaction 6831d7576c57925675a432075da06ba07c7fda26e16d66000128d05ab0152bd8

1 Input
2 Outputs
  • 6831d7576c57925675a432075da06ba07c7fda26e16d66000128d05ab0152bd8:0
  • value  28190
    address  1KFVPbHtLahiuAozXuCkXPR7ULf68Z2rhn
  • 6831d7576c57925675a432075da06ba07c7fda26e16d66000128d05ab0152bd8:1
  • value  84956710
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C